**Job Description:**
The Sr. Credit Products Manager in Dealer Financial Services is accountable for helping to design and deliver credit solutions and for underwriting, structuring and negotiating these solutions at the market level. The Sr. CPM leads a team of portfolio management officers and analysts who provide credit structuring, underwriting and monitoring expertise. Dealer Financial Services supports the financial needs of publicly and privately held franchised automobile dealers, our credit product suite includes floor plan funding for inventory, real estate term loans, acquisition /expansion financing, as well as derivative products (interest rate swaps) and a full spectrum of Treasury Management products and services. The Sr. CPM partners closely with client-facing teammates in both the Global Investment Bank and Global Commercial Bank to consult on sales opportunities, and provide the product expertise and consultation necessary to deliver the best possible solution to the client. The Sr. CPM will be responsible for highly complex portfolios with multiple businesses in the Western Region of the US.
